domingo, 21 de marzo de 2010

Proyecto # 3 Algoritmo recursivo-iterativo

Bueno me encuentro aquí de nuevo con el tercer proyecto de este semestre de la materia Algoritmos Computacionales debo admitir que este tema resultó sencillo de entender en computación de los anteriores pero aun así tuvo su reto característico bueno pues empecemos

Que es recursividad: pues en mis palabras podría decir que un algoritmo recursivo es aquél que hace llamada a una subrutina, esto quiere decir que llama a una secuencia de pasos ya definidos por una función esto nos hace que nuestro algoritmo se vea mas simple y corto, pero nos afecta en cuestión de memoria ya que gasta mas que un algoritmo iterativo

Es conveniente usarse cuando esa función es valida usarla para distintos tipos de algoritmos ya que a la larga ese gasto en memoria puede significar un gran ahorro en tiempo y rendimiento.

A su vez no es conveniente usarlo cuando se trata de programas pequeños o que no requieran de un algoritmo muy complejo.

Con respecto a este proyecto nuestro equipo trabajo un poco desorganizado al inicio pero nos pudimos poner de acuerdo para realizarlo correctamente, destacando el área de saber como distribuir el trabajo correctamente para cada integrante.

Mi contribución fue en la ejecución de pasos de un algoritmo0 recursivo que nos toco fue un poco estresante al inicio debido a que aun tenia muchas dudas acerca del tema pero conforme iba entendiendo esas dudas se disiparon.

Esto fue acerca del compórtamiento de un algoritmo recursivo con complejidad

O(f(3n+5)) tomando en cuenta la función g(4n+5)
debo admitir que fue interesante analizar este algoritmo y compararlo con el iterativo


Con respecto a mi participación en el equipo pienso que no hice mas ni menos que los demás solo hice lo que debía hacer y poner de mi parte para el proyecto en equipo.

Para posibles proyectos posteriores en esta y otras materias seria prudente de mi parte una mejor capacidad de organizacion conmigo mismo y los integrantes del equipo.

Bueno pues les recomiendo que vean la presentación que formamos y nos den su punto de vista acerca del análisis que hicimos.

Integrantes del equipo:
Jonathan De la Rosa Gonzalez
Dora Nelly Gonzalez Martinez
Joel Angel Escamilla Montemayor

Y un servidor.

Liga de la presentación del equipo:
Proyecto # 3
Archivo para Descarga:
Proyecto # 3

No hay comentarios:

Publicar un comentario

Seguidores